#040219 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#040219 is composed of 1.6% red, 0.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 90.2% black. It has a hue angle of 245.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 5.3%. #040219 color hex could be obtained by blending #080432 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#040219

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010107 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#040219

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0d0d0e is the less saturated color, while #03011a is the most saturated one.
